This is another one I got for free on Amazon and oh my goodness please run to get this. This book might easily be one of my favorites I’ve ever read. The Italian scenery is so well elaborated that it feels like you’re there yourself. I could almost taste the yummy foods they were making in cooking class. The witty conversations between Ginny and Preston made me laugh over and over again, as well as the silly actions of Ginny. I did not expect the academic vibe to match this good with the romantic holiday vibe, but it turns out to be the perfect mix of romance and ancient history facts (which I love!). Now I’m left with the craving to read more academic Italian romcoms!
